Roles and Responsibilities

  • You will manage a varied caseload of residential property matters, including:
    • Freehold and leasehold sales and purchases
    • Development acquisitions and disposals
    • Re-sales
    • Title investigation and associated matters
  • Your responsibilities will include:
    • Drafting and negotiating contracts and leases
    • Handling SDLT submissions, including reliefs
    • Investigating and resolving title issues
    • Managing restrictive covenant variations and releases
    • Running matters independently from instruction through to completion
    • Delivering a consistently high standard of client care
